1. The Birth of a Legend: Converse History 101
Converse was born in Malden, Massachusetts, in 1908, when Marquis Mills Converse decided to start a rubber shoe company. Fast forward to 1917, and the Chuck Taylor All Star made its debut โ a sneaker that would soon become synonymous with American style and street culture. Chuck Taylor, a basketball player and salesman, lent his name to the shoe, and the rest is history. ๐๐
The Chuck Taylor All Star wasnโt just a sneaker; it was a symbol of rebellion and individuality. From jazz musicians to rock stars, everyone from Chuck Berry to Kurt Cobain wore them. They were the canvas upon which generations painted their identities. ๐ธ๐จ
